Mica is a mineral name given to a group of minerals that are physically and chemically similar. They are all silicate minerals, known as sheet silicates because they form in distinct layers. Micas are fairly light and relatively soft, and the sheets and flakes of mica are flexible. Mica is heat-resistant and does not conduct electricity.

Flotation Frothers What is the Function of Frothers. The function of frothers in flotation is that of building the froth which serves as the buoyant medium in the separation of the floatable from the non-floatable minerals. Frothers accomplish this by lowering the surface tension of the liquid which in turn permits air rising through the pulp to accumulate at the surface in bubble form.

Feb 10, 2018· The tailings of mica flotation are used for later spodumene flotation. Fig. 4 (b) is the locked flowsheet of first grinding - coarse mica flotation - tailings regrinding - desliming - spodumene floatation. In the flowsheet, the ore is ground to 50% passing 74 μm in the first grinding process, after which coarse mica flotation is performed.

Maximum flotation occurred at pH 8 and correlated to a tightly packed hydrophobic collector monolayer giving maximum hydrophobicity to the mica surface. From extended DLVO theory, it was shown that heterocoagulation between the bubble and the mica could only occur providing there was a very long range hydrophobic interaction force to ...

Aug 01, 2018· The amount of Al 2 O 3 in the flotation concentrates can also indicate the amount of muscovite reporting to the concentrate. However, only 3%, 6%, and 13% Al 2 O 3 were found in the flotation concentrates when 10%, 20% and 30% muscovite was added. This indicate that muscovite behaves differently from talc in flotation process.

2.4 Mica Ore Flotation Flotation experiments on the mica ore were carried out in a 3 L Denver flotation cell at an air flow rate of 4.5 L/min using Cp-102a as frother. For each test a fresh batch of ore (500 g) was rod milled wet and then transferred directly to the flotation cell where the pulp level was adjusted to a set height by adding tap ...

Mica, present as an impurity in kaolin clay, is removed from the clay particles by stage-wise froth flotation of the clay in a dispersed alkaline pulp, using as a collector for the clay a complex phosphate ester of a nonionic surfactant of the ethylene oxide-adduct type.
